Record and Growth:
Internet poker emerged into the belated 1990s as a result of developments in technology and the internet. The initial online poker room,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a little but passionate community. However, it was in the first 2000s that online poker practiced exponential growth,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of Internet Poker:
On-line Highstakes Poker provides a number of benefits over old-fashioned br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a larger range of game options, including numerous poker alternatives and stakes, catering to your preferences and spending plans of all kinds of people. In addition, online poker rooms are open 24/7, eliminating the limitations of physical casino operating hours. Moreover, on line systems usually provide appealing incentives, commitment programs, and the power to play numerous tables simultaneously, enhancing the general video gaming experience.
